Otis R Barker 1908 - 1976

Otis R Barker of Odessa, Lafayette County, Missouri was born on April 19, 1908, and died at age 68 years old in July 1976.

In 1911, by the time he was only 3 years old, the first use of aircraft as an offensive weapon occurred in the Turkish-Italian War. First used for aerial reconnaissance alone, planes were then used in aerial combat to shoot down recon planes. In World War I, planes and zeppelins evolved for use in bombing.
